Trace Element Mapping of a Biological Specimen by a Full‐Field X‐ray Fluorescence Imaging Microscope with a Wolter Mirror

2007 
A full‐field X‐ray fluorescence imaging microscope with a Wolter mirror was applied to the element mapping of alfalfa seeds. The X‐ray fluorescence microscope was built at the Photon Factory BL3C2 (KEK). X‐ray fluorescence images of several growing stages of the alfalfa seeds were obtained. X‐ray fluorescence energy spectra were measured with either a solid state detector or a CCD photon counting method. The element distributions of iron and zinc which were included in the seeds were obtained using a photon counting method.
